Stonegate Group is seeking a Kitchen Team Member for Slug And Lettuce Oxford Circus. In this role, you will enhance your culinary skills while contributing to the success of our kitchen.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Assisting food preparation
  • Ensuring cleanliness
  • Managing deliveries

Candidates should have a passion for hospitality, a willingness to learn, and the ability to maintain kitchen equipment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Stonegate Group

Know Your Culinary Basics

Brush up on your cooking skills and kitchen terminology before the interview. Being able to discuss food preparation techniques or your favourite dishes can show your passion for the role and help you connect with the interviewer.

Show Your Hospitality Spirit

Prepare examples of how you've provided excellent service in the past. Whether it's a time you went above and beyond for a customer or worked well in a team, sharing these stories will highlight your passion for hospitality.

Be Ready to Discuss Cleanliness

Since maintaining cleanliness is key in any kitchen, think about how you ensure hygiene in your previous roles. Be prepared to talk about your approach to keeping workspaces tidy and safe, as this will demonstrate your commitment to kitchen standards.

Ask About Growth Opportunities

Show your willingness to learn by asking about training and development opportunities within the kitchen team. This not only shows your enthusiasm for the role but also your desire to grow within the company.
